Fixed line penetration as a percentage of population rose 7.21% to 25.2% in Brunei in 2021, according to World Bank.
Historically, fixed line penetration as a percentage of population in Brunei reached an all time high of 26.0% in 2001 and an all time low of 4.22% in 1977. When compared to Brunei's main peers, fixed line penetration as a percentage of population in Indonesia amounted to 3.29%, 24.6% in Malaysia, 4.42% in Philippines and 3.20% in Vietnam in 2021.
Brunei has been ranked 34th within the group of 140 countries we follow in terms of fixed line penetration as a percentage of population, 36 places above the position seen 10 years ago.
